The Advantages of Visual Elements in Tech Presentations

Visual elements are critical in tech presentations because they help to simplify complex information, engage the audience, and reinforce your message. Here are several reasons why incorporating visual elements in tech presentations is essential:

Enhancing Comprehension

Visuals can simplify complex technical concepts, making them easier to understand. Diagrams, charts, and infographics can break down intricate data into digestible pieces.

Boosting Engagement

Engaging visuals keep the audience’s attention focused on your presentation. Dynamic elements like animations and videos can make your presentation more lively and captivating.

Supporting Memory Retention

People are more likely to remember information presented visually. Combining visuals with verbal information helps reinforce your message and improves recall.

Key Visual Elements to Include in Tech Presentations

Infographics

Infographics are powerful tools for presenting complex data in a visually appealing and easy-to-understand format. In tech presentations, they can illustrate processes, compare technologies, or highlight key statistics. Infographics combine text, images, and design to convey information efficiently.

Charts and Graphs

Charts and graphs are essential for presenting numerical data clearly. They help to visualize trends, comparisons, and patterns, making your data more accessible to the audience. Common types include bar charts, pie charts, and line graphs.

Diagrams and Flowcharts

Diagrams and flowcharts are useful for mapping out processes, systems, or workflows. They can help explain complex technical systems or show the steps in a process, making it easier for the audience to follow along.

Images and Icons

High-quality images and icons can make your tech presentation more visually engaging. Images can illustrate points, add visual interest, and provide a break from text-heavy slides. Icons can help to highlight key points and make slides more visually appealing.

Videos and Animations

Videos and animations can add a dynamic element to your tech presentations. They can be used to demonstrate product features, show a process in action, or provide visual interest. Animations can also be used to gradually reveal information, helping to keep the audience engaged.

Best Practices for Incorporating Visual Elements

While visual elements can significantly enhance tech presentations, it’s essential to use them effectively. Here are some best practices to consider:

Keep It Simple

Avoid cluttering your slides with too many visual elements. Focus on clarity and simplicity to ensure your message is not lost.

Consistent Design

Maintain a consistent design throughout your presentation. Use a cohesive color scheme, font style, and layout to create a professional look.

Relevance

Ensure all visual elements are relevant to your content. Avoid using visuals that do not support or enhance your message.

Quality Over Quantity

Prioritize high-quality visuals over a large quantity. A few well-designed visual elements can be more impactful than many low-quality ones.

Engage Your Audience

Use visual elements to engage your audience actively. Ask questions, invite interaction, and use visuals to prompt discussion.
